#3310b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3310b8 is composed of 20% red, 6.3%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 252.5 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 39.2%. #3310b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#6620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3310b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3310b8 has RGB values of R:51, G:16,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 3346616.

Shades and Tints of #3310b8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f3f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3310b8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605d6b is the less saturated color, while #2a01c7 is the most saturated one.
